이 가이드는 파이썬에서 포토샵 레이어 효과를 적용하는 프로그래밍 접근 방식을 보여줍니다. Aspose.PSD for Python via .NET은 그림자, 스트로크 및 광선과 같은 효과를 적용하는 클래스 및 메서드를 제공합니다. 또한, 기능을 구현하기 위한 코드 샘플을 작성할 것입니다. 가장 좋은 점은 Adobe Photoshop에 대한 의존성을 제거합니다. 이 튜토리얼이 끝나면 PSD 조작을 자동화할 수 있습니다. 이 SDK는 강력하며 디자인 템플릿에 대한 프로세스 자동화를 원하는 파이썬 개발자에게 적합합니다.
Python SDK 설치
SDK 파일을 다운로드하거나 터미널/CMD에서 다음 명령을 실행할 수 있습니다:
pip install aspose-psd
설치가 완료되면 구현을 위해 준비가 완료됩니다.
파이썬에서 포토샵 레이어 효과 적용하기 - 코드 스니펫
다음 단계에 따라 프로그래밍 방식으로 포토샵에서 레이어를 편집할 수 있습니다:
- PNG 옵션을 설정하려면 PngOptions 클래스의 인스턴스를 생성합니다.
- PSD 로드 옵션을 설정하려면 PsdLoadOptions 클래스의 객체를 생성합니다.
- load 메서드를 호출하여 PSD 이미지를 로드합니다.
- 레이어 1에 스트로크를 추가하고, 레이어 2에 내부 그림자를 추가하고, 레이어 3에 드롭 그림자를 추가하고, 레이어 4에 그래디언트 오버레이를 추가하고, 레이어 5에 색상 오버레이를 추가하고, 레이어 6에 패턴 오버레이를 추가하고, 레이어 7에 외부 광선을 추가합니다.
- 수정된 이미지를 PNG로 저장하려면 save 메서드를 호출합니다.
다음 코드 스니펫은 파이썬에서 포토샵 레이어 효과를 프로그래밍 방식으로 적용하는 방법을 보여줍니다:
출력:
질문이 있나요?
질문이 있다면 포럼에 질문하실 수 있습니다.
PSD 조작 - 무료 라이센스 받기
Aspose.PSD for Python via .NET을 사용해 보려면 무료 임시 라이센스를 받을 수 있습니다.
결론
Aspose.PSD for Python via .NET은 포토샵 소프트웨어를 열지 않고도 풍부한 PSD 이미지를 작업할 수 있게 해줍니다. 반복적인 편집을 자동화하고 효율성을 높이는 데 도움이 됩니다. 파이썬에서 포토샵 레이어 효과를 적용하는 방법을 살펴보았습니다. 추가적으로 문서 및 API 참조를 통해 포괄적인 통찰력을 얻을 수 있습니다.
자주 묻는 질문
Q: 포토샵에서 레이어 효과를 추가하는 방법은?
A: Aspose.PSD for Python via .NET를 사용하여 포토샵 레이어 효과를 적용할 수 있습니다. 이 링크에서 코드 스니펫을 제공합니다.
Q: PSD에서 그림자를 추가하는 방법은?
A: Aspose.PSD for Python via .NET를 사용하여 레이어의 혼합 옵션에 접근하고 add_drop_shadow() 또는 add_inner_shadow() 메서드를 적용하여 PSD 파일에 그림자를 추가할 수 있습니다.